The Seattle Sounders host the Portland Timbers at Lumen Field in a Cascadia rivalry clash that carries real playoff implications for the home side. This Seattle Sounders vs Portland Timbers prediction strongly favors the hosts, who hold a commanding seven-place advantage in the Western Conference standings and a 0.85 points-per-game edge over their rivals.
Seattle sit sixth in the West with 24 points, firmly in playoff contention. Portland, by contrast, are 13th with just 14 points and a negative goal difference, struggling badly away from home — winning just one of eight road games this season. The Timbers have conceded two goals per game on average, making them vulnerable against a Sounders attack that has been solid at Lumen Field.
Both sides carry injury concerns. Seattle are missing several players including P. de La Vega, P. Arriola, and two others, while Portland are without O. Fernandez, D. Chara, and J. Caicedo. The Timbers' absentee list hits harder given their already-thin squad depth.
With Portland's dismal away record, a leaky defense, and Seattle's home fortress advantage — losing just once at Lumen Field this season — the Sounders are clear favorites. A home win is the most likely outcome, and the combined goals-per-game rate of 2.88 suggests this rivalry match could produce a lively scoreline.

Looking at head-to-head meetings within the last two years, Seattle won the most recent encounter 1-0 at Lumen Field in October 2025, while the May 2025 meeting at Portland ended 1-1. The 2024 meetings produced a draw at Seattle and a Portland home win. In recent H2H, draws are common and Seattle have the edge on home soil. The pattern suggests tight, competitive matches — but Seattle's current form advantage over Portland is far greater than in previous seasons.

Seattle have been solid overall this season, winning seven of thirteen MLS matches and conceding fewer than one goal per game on average. Their home record is particularly strong — four wins, one draw, and just one loss at Lumen Field. The Sounders showed resilience by beating San Jose and FC Dallas at home in April, though back-to-back losses to LA Galaxy and LAFC in late May were a concern. Injuries to P. de La Vega, P. Arriola, Y. Gomez Andrade, and N. Petkovic are notable, but the squad has enough depth to handle Portland's weakened attack.

Portland's 2026 campaign has been deeply disappointing. The Timbers have won just four of fourteen MLS matches and are conceding two goals per game — the worst defensive rate among teams in this analysis. Away from home, they have won just once in eight attempts, conceding heavily on the road. A 6-0 thrashing of Sporting Kansas City in May flatters their recent numbers. Injuries to O. Fernandez, D. Chara, J. Caicedo, and Z. McGraw further weaken a squad already struggling for consistency. Portland arrive at Lumen Field in poor form and with little to suggest an upset is coming.
